5 Kilometer Level II 18-Week Plan

$15.00

The 18-week Level II 5km plans are intended for individuals who have been training aerobically for 2-3 hours per week and/or have previous experience running 5km events. This plan works up to 5 hours of running volume for the peak week of training. Consider your previous and current training experience before choosing this option. If you have any questions about whether this plan is appropriate for your particular circumstances, please contact Zach.

About this plan:

  • This plan is a good fit for people who have some experience running and/or have completed a periodized 5km training plan previously.

  • This plan includes strength training, dynamic movements, stretching/mobility recommendations, which depending on your availability and desire will add 1-2 hours of total training volume per week.

  • This plan provides guidance on which workouts would ideally be performed on event specific terrain.

  • This plan is periodized. It focuses on workouts that are least specific to event day intensity first. As the plan progresses, primary workout intensities will become closer to event day intensities.

  • This plan includes: short intervals, long intervals, tempo runs, and long runs.

  • This plan uses time and intensity as the metric to track workout duration and difficulty.

  • This plan includes detailed workout descriptions with multiple guides for determining workout intensity.

  • This plan encourages using rate of perceived exertion (guide included) as a guide. It includes heart rate, and descriptive cues as well.
